  • Publication number: 20190006676
    Abstract: The present invention is directed to a lithium ion battery electrode slurry composition comprising: (a) an electrochemically active material capable of lithium intercalation and deintercalation; (b) a binder dispersed in an aqueous or organic medium and comprising a reaction product of a reaction mixture comprising one or more epoxy functional polymer(s) and one or more acid functional acrylic polymer(s); and (c) an electrically conductive agent. The present invention also provides an electrode comprising: (a) an electrical current collector; and (b) a cured film formed on the electrical current collector. The cured film is deposited from the slurry composition described above. Electrical storage devices prepared from the electrode are also provided.

  • Publication number: 20190002709
    Abstract: An aqueous dispersion includes an aqueous medium and self-crosslinkable core-shell particles dispersed in the aqueous medium. The core-shell particles include (1) a polymeric core at least partially encapsulated by (2) a polymeric shell having urethane linkages, keto and/or aldo functional groups, and hydrazide functional groups. Further, the polymeric core is covalently bonded to at least a portion of the polymeric shell.

  • Publication number: 20180268556
    Abstract: Method and system for tracking moving objects in a video with non-stationary background is provided. The method comprises estimation of non-stationary background and determining an approximate foreground for each image that learns the background model over time by incorporating various constraints on image pixels. Then, weights based upon spatio-temporal statistical properties of the extracted foreground blobs and blob edge overlap are used to identify and track with bounding boxes displayed for one or more true objects.

  • Patent number: 9948503
    Abstract: Each of a first group of gateway nodes of a communications network operates as a primary gateway identified by a respective unique gateway identification number (GWID), and each of a second group of gateway nodes operates as a backup gateway. Each gateway node has an assigned backup priority level with respect to each GWID. The gateway nodes are interconnected via a common local network. In the event that a primary gateway node becomes non-operational, the backup gateway that is assigned the highest priority level with respect to the GWID of the non-operational primary gateway assumes operation as the primary gateway identified by that GWID. Upon restoration of the non-operational gateway node, the gateway node operates as a backup gateway in place of the gateway node that assumed its operation as the primary gateway. A gateway node operates as a primary gateway for only one respective GWID at a time.

  • Patent number: 9938425
    Abstract: A method for applying a multilayer coating comprising a basecoat and a clearcoat is disclosed. The basecoat is a curable aqueous composition comprising (1) polymeric particles prepared from ethylenically unsaturated compounds including a multi-ethylenically unsaturated monomer and a keto or aldo-functional monomer, and (2) a polyhydrazide. A hydrophobic polymer is present in the aqueous composition to improve its humidity resistance.

  • Patent number: 9832131
    Abstract: Approaches for managing characteristics for inbound data communications between a first network site and a remote network site of a WAN are provided. The inbound communications are received by the first network site via a series of links of the WAN. Protocol overhead factors are determined based on overhead associated with network protocols applied to the data communications over the links. Link throughput limits are determined for the inbound data communications, wherein the throughput limits are determined based on the protocol overhead factors. The throughput limits are transmitted to the second network site for transmission of the inbound data communications from the second network site. The inbound data communications are received by a first device of the first network site via the first link, wherein the first link is between the first device and a second device serving as an exit point from a public portion of the WAN.
